Understanding Provable Fairness in Online Gaming
Provable fairness is a revolutionary concept in the online gambling industry. It’s a system that allows players to verify that each game outcome is genuinely random and hasn't been manipulated by the casino operator. Unlike traditional casino games where the randomness is based on proprietary algorithms, provably fair systems utilize cryptographic hashing and seed generation to ensure transparency. The core principle revolves around three key components: the server seed, the client seed, and the nonce. The server seed is generated by the casino, while the client seed is contributed by the player. The nonce is a value that increments with each bet. These elements are combined through a hashing algorithm to produce a result that determines the game outcome. Players can then use publicly available tools to verify this process and confirm the fairness of the game. This level of transparency builds trust and empowers players with control over their gaming experience.
How Seed Generation Works
The effectiveness of a provably fair system hinges on the secure and random generation of seeds. The server seed, controlled by the casino, needs to be unpredictable and non-manipulable. Casinos often use a combination of true random number generators (TRNGs) and verifiable randomness sources. The client seed, provided by the player, adds an element of player control and ensures that each game is unique to that individual. The nonce, acting as a counter, ensures that each bet generates a different outcome, even with the same seeds. The hashing process, typically utilizing algorithms like SHA-256, combines these three components into a deterministic result. The ability for players to independently verify these seeds and the hashing process is the cornerstone of provable fairness. This prevents any possibility of pre-determination of results on the part of the casino itself, offering peace of mind to the player.
| Component | Description |
|---|---|
| Server Seed | Generated by the casino; kept secret until after the bet. |
| Client Seed | Provided by the player; contributes to randomness. |
| Nonce | A number incrementing with each bet; ensures uniqueness. |
| Hashing Algorithm | Combines seeds and nonce to generate a deterministic result. |

The Rise of Live Dealer Games
Live dealer games have become increasingly popular in recent years, bridging the gap between the convenience of online gaming and the immersive experience of a brick-and-mortar casino. These games feature real-life dealers conducting the action via live video streams, allowing players to interact with the dealer and other players in real-time. Popular live dealer games include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ker. The appeal of live dealer games lies in the added element of social interaction and the transparency of seeing the cards being dealt or the roulette wheel spinning in real-time. The quality of the live stream, the professionalism of the dealers, and the availability of different betting limits are all key factors that contribute to the overall live dealer experience. They provide an added layer of assurance for players who prefer a more authentic casino feel and the sociability of an in-person experience.

Payment Methods and Security Measures
A seamless and secure payment process is vital for any online casino. Players need to be confident that their financial transactions are protected and that withdrawals are processed efficiently. Reputable online casinos offer a variety of payment methods, including credit and deb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um. Security is paramount, and casinos employ robust encryption technologies,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), to protect sensitive data during transmission. Furthermore, casinos must comply with strict regulatory requirements regarding anti-money laundering (AML) and know your customer (KYC) procedures. These measures help to prevent fraud and ensure the integrity of the platform. Importance of Licensing and Regulation
Licensing and regulation play a critical role in ensuring the safety and fairness of online casinos. Reputable casinos operate under licenses issued by recognized regulatory auth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), and the Curacao eGaming. These regulatory bodies enforce strict standards regarding player protection, responsible gaming, and the prevention of illegal activities. A valid license signifies that the casino has undergone rigorous scrutiny and meets the required standards of operation. Players should always verify that a casino holds a valid license before depositing any funds or engaging in real-money gameplay. The presence of a license is a strong indicator of the casino's commitment to fairness and transparency, providing players with a level of security and peace of mind. Beyond the Games: Responsible Gaming and Customer Support
A reputable online casino prioritizes responsible gaming and provides adequate customer support. Responsible gaming tools,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options, empower players to manage their gambling habits and avoid potential problems. Casinos also have a responsibility to identify and assist players who may be exhibiting signs of problem gambling. Effective customer support is equally important. Players need to be able to easily contact the casino with any questions or concerns. This typically involves offering multiple support channels, such as live chat, email, and phone support. The support team should be knowledgeable, responsive, and helpful.
